AN ACT RELATING TO TAXATION -- PROPERTY SUBJECT TO TAXATION -- TAX EXEMPTIONS -- JAMESTOWN
HB 7243 grants the town of Jamestown the authority to offer property tax reductions to two specific groups: parents of military service members who died in the line of duty and legally blind residents. Under this law, Jamestown can provide a tax dollar reduction of up to $5,000 for gold star parents and a similar credit for visually impaired individuals who meet federal certification standards. The bill amends state statutes to allow other municipalities to set their own exemption amounts, but specifically authorizes Jamestown to implement these benefits through local ordinance. This change enables the town to directly lower property tax bills for eligible families and individuals without altering the broader state tax code.
